Active ingredients

Algeldrat + Magnesium hydroxide

Composition

5 ml (1 scool) alladrat (aluminum hydroxide gel) 2.18 g, which corresponds to an aluminum oxide content of 218 mg magnesium hydroxide paste 350 mg, which corresponds to a magnesium content of oxide 75 mg Auxiliary substances: sorbitol - 801.15 mg, gietelloza - 10.9 mg, methyl parahydroxybenzoate - 10.9 mg, propyl parahydroxybenzoate - 1.363 mg, butyl parahydroxybenzoate - 1.363 mg, sodium saccharinate dihydrate - 818 μg, lemon oil - 1.635 mg, ethanol 96% - 98.1 mg, purified water - up to 5 ml.

Pharmacological effect

Antacid preparation, which is a balanced combination of allegrite (aluminum hydroxide) and magnesium hydroxide. Neutralizes free hydrochloric acid in the stomach, reduces the activity of pepsin, which leads to a decrease in the digestive activity of gastric juice. It has an enveloping, adsorbing effect. It protects the gastric mucosa by stimulating the synthesis of prostaglandins (cytoprotective effect). It protects the mucosa from inflammatory and erosive hemorrhagic lesions as a result of the use of irritating and ulcerogenic agents such as ethanol, NSAIDs (for example, indomethacin, diclofenac, acetylsalicylic acid), corticosteroids. The therapeutic effect after taking the drug occurs in 3-5 minutes. The duration of action depends on the rate of gastric emptying. When taken on an empty stomach, the effect lasts up to 60 minutes. When taken an hour after eating, the antacid effect can last up to 3 hours. It does not cause secondary hypersecretion of gastric juice.

Pharmacokinetics

Algeldrat: A small amount of the drug is absorbed, which practically does not change the concentration of aluminum salts in the blood. Excreted through the intestines. Magnesium hydroxide: Magnesium ions are absorbed in small amounts (about 10% of the dose taken) and do not change the concentration of magnesium in the blood. Distributed usually locally. Magnesium hydroxide is excreted through the intestines.

Contraindications

- severe renal failure (due to the risk of hypermagnesium and aluminum intoxication) - Alzheimer's disease - hypophosphatemia - pregnancy - children under 10 years old - congenital fructose intolerance (the drug contains sorbitol) - hypersensitivity to active substances and auxiliary components of the drug.

Use during pregnancy and lactation

Experimental studies in animals have shown no teratogenic potential or other undesirable effects on the embryo and / or fetus. There is no clinical data on the use of the drug Almagel in pregnant women. The drug is not recommended for use in pregnancy, but if the intended benefit to the mother outweighs the potential risk to the fetus, Almagel should be taken under the supervision of a doctor for no more than 5-6 days. There is no data on the release of the active substances of the drug in breast milk. Almagel can be used during breastfeeding only after a careful assessment of the ratio of the intended benefits to the mother and the potential risk to the baby. During lactation, the drug is recommended to use no more than 5-6 days under the supervision of a physician.

Dosage and administration

The drug is taken orally. Before each use, the suspension must be thoroughly homogenized by shaking the bottle. Treatment The drug is taken 45-60 minutes after a meal and in the evening before bedtime. Adults and children over 15 years old are prescribed 5-10 ml (1-2 scoops) 3-4 times / day. If necessary, a single dose can be increased to 15 ml (3 scoops). Children aged 10 to 15 years prescribed in a dose equal to half the dose for adults. After reaching a therapeutic effect, the daily dose is reduced to 5 ml (1 scoop) 3-4 times / day for 15-20 days. It is not recommended to take fluids for 15 minutes after taking Almagel. Prevention On 5-15 ml for 15 min. Before taking medication with irritant action.

Side effects

On the part of the digestive system: perhaps - constipation, which passes after a dose reduction in rare cases - nausea, vomiting, stomach cramps, change in taste. On the part of the nervous system: with prolonged use of the drug in patients with renal insufficiency and patients on dialysis, changes in mood and mental activity are possible. Others: in rare cases - allergic reactions and hypermagnesia with prolonged use in high doses (in combination with a deficiency of phosphorus in food), osteomalacia may develop.

Overdose

Symptoms: with a single overdose - constipation, flatulence, metallic taste in the mouth. With prolonged use in high doses, the formation of kidney stones, the development of severe constipation, slight drowsiness, hypermagnemia.There may also be signs of metabolic alkalosis: changes in mood or mental activity, numbness or pain in the muscles, irritability and fatigue, slowing breathing, unpleasant taste sensations. Treatment: it is necessary to take immediate steps to quickly remove the drug from the body - gastric lavage, stimulation of vomiting, taking activated charcoal.

Interaction with other drugs

It can adsorb some drugs, thus reducing their absorption. Therefore, with the simultaneous use of other drugs, it is necessary to observe the interval of 1-2 hours between taking the drug Almagel and other means. Almagel changes the pH of the gastric juice in the alkaline direction, which can affect the action of a significant number of drugs with simultaneous use. Almagel reduces the effect of histamine H2-receptor blockers (cimetidine, ranitidine, famotidine), cardiac glycosides, iron salts, lithium preparations, quinidine, mexiletine, phenothiazine preparations, tetracycline antibiotics, ciprofloxacin, isoniazid and ketoconazaz With the simultaneous appointment of enteric forms of drugs should be remembered that the increase in the pH of gastric juice, caused by taking the drug Almagel, can lead to accelerated destruction of the enteric membrane and thereby cause irritation of the mucous membrane of the stomach and duodenum. Almagel may affect the results of some laboratory and functional studies and tests: reduces the level of gastric secretion in determining the acidity of gastric juice changes test results using technetium (99mTc), for example, bone scintigraphy and some tests for the study of the esophagus increases the serum phosphorus concentration, changes pH values ​​of serum and urine.

special instructions

It is not recommended to use the drug in patients with severe constipation, with pain in the stomach of unknown origin and suspected acute appendicitis, the presence of ulcerative colitis, diverticulosis, colostomy or ileostomy, chronic diarrhea, acute hemorrhoids, changes in acid-base balance in the body, as well as metabolic alkalosis, cirrhosis of the liver, severe heart failure, toxicosis of pregnant women, impaired renal function ((CC less than 30 ml / min) due to the risk of hypermagneemia and aluminum intoxication).In patients with renal failure with prolonged use of the drug (more than 20 days), regular monitoring of serum magnesium concentration is necessary. The drug does not contain sugar, which allows you to take it to patients with diabetes. The drug contains sorbitol, therefore it is contraindicated in cases of congenital fructose intolerance. Influence on the ability to drive vehicles and control mechanisms Almagel does not affect the ability to drive and work with mechanisms. When taken in the recommended daily dose, the ethanol contained in the preparation does not affect the ability to drive a car and work with mechanisms.
